Fan-out backpressure for the Quillet notifier: when the queue depth crosses the soft limit, the dispatcher sheds low-priority pushes and batches the rest at 500ms intervals. Reviewer should confirm the shed counter is exported and that retries respect the jitter window. Once merged, the release artifact gets re-signed by the pipeline, which expects the deploy key shown below.

deploy key for bawep-yawif: bky6_GQhaSt

Hey Marisol — handing off the SnackRoute restock planner before my rotation ends. The optimizer service runs on the Quellton cluster, and the security review notes from last quarter are in the shared drive. Main thing for your audit: the admin console uses a sealed recovery flow, not per-user resets. If the planner's config store ever gets wedged, you'll need the recovery passphrase to unseal it. Here it is:

vault phrase of bagaf-kajeg = jorath-feniel-briir-siliel-ralix

While Penderly House is under renovation, all night-shift staff report to the interim facility at Corvane Mews. Please note that the Mews runs on a separate access system from Penderly, so your usual badge will not open exterior doors there until Facilities syncs the registers, which happens weekly on Thursdays. Arrive at least fifteen minutes early for your first shift, sign the night register at the loading-bay kiosk, and confirm your name with the duty supervisor. Until your badge syncs, use the night-entry code below.

door code, yagap-bahof: bdg-O-05